Header ads

Header ads
» » Truy vấn Tham số (Parameter Query) trong Access 2016

Truy vấn tham số (Parameter Query) là một trong những truy vấn đơn giản và hữu ích nhất mà bạn có thể tạo trong Access. Chính vì lý do đó mà ta hoàn toàn có thể dễ dàng cập nhật để phản ánh kết quả của các từ khóa tìm kiếm.

    Cách tạo và chạy truy vấn tham số

    Để tạo lập và chạy được một truy vấn tham số, ta lần lượt thực hiện các bước như sau:

    1. Tạo một truy vấn như bình thường, chỉnh sửa các tham số trong bảng dữ liệu nếu cần, chọn các trường dữ liệu muốn thêm vào truy vấn rồi thêm các kỳ tiêu chí không thay đổi vào trường thích hợp trong hàng Criteria.

    2. Xác định các trường mà bạn muốn điền tiêu chí truy vấn biến đổi vào, sau đó click chọn hàng Criteria.

    3. Nhập cụm từ thông báo mà bạn muốn xuất hiện mỗi khi thực hiện truy vấn. Lưu ý cụm từ đó phải được đính kèm trong ngoặc vuông [].

    4. Trên tab Design, click vào lệnh Run để chạy truy vấn. Một hộp thoại thông báo sẽ xuất hiện yêu cầu bạn cung cấp thông tin. Nhập từ khóa tìm kiếm và click vào OK để xem kết quả truy vấn.

    Ví dụ

    Bây giờ chúng ta hãy xem một ví dụ đơn giản tạo một truy vấn tham số.

    Đầu tiên, mở cơ sở dữ liệu Access của bạn, chọn Query Design trong tab Create.

    Vào tab Create và chọn Query Design để xuất hiện Show Table
    Vào tab Create và chọn Query Design để xuất hiện Show Table

    Trong Show Table, chọn bảng muốn truy vấn, ở đây là tblDuAn, click đúp chuột vào và chọn Close.

    Tên các trường của tblDuAn sẽ hiện lên để bạn chọn
    Tên các trường của tblDuAn sẽ hiện lên để bạn chọn

    Chọn trường bạn muốn xem dưới dạng kết quả truy vấn, ví dụ như trong ảnh chụp màn hình sau.

    Chọn trường DuAnID, TenDuAn, NgayBatdau, NgayKetthuc
    Chọn trường DuAnID, TenDuAn, NgayBatdau, NgayKetthuc

    Tìm dự án bắt đầu vào một ngày xác định

    Trong ô Criteria của cột NgayBatdau ở phần lưới thiết kế dưới cùng màn hình, nhập cụm từ thông báo mà bạn muốn xuất hiện khi thực hiện truy vấn: [Nhập ngày bắt đầu dự án:]

    Cụm từ thông báo [Nhập ngày bắt đầu dự án:] sẽ xuất hiện khi chạy truy vấn
    Cụm từ thông báo [Nhập ngày bắt đầu dự án:] sẽ xuất hiện khi chạy truy vấn

    Tiếp theo, click Run trên tab Design và bạn sẽ thấy thông báo hiện lên

    Hộp thông báo [Nhập ngày bắt đầu dự án:] xuất hiện
    Hộp thông báo [Nhập ngày bắt đầu dự án:] xuất hiện

    Giờ bạn nhập thử 1 ngày bắt đầu dự án.

    Nhập thử ngày 12 tháng 2 năm 2016 (định dạng m/d/y)
    Nhập thử ngày 12 tháng 2 năm 2016 (định dạng m/d/y)

    Click OK để xác nhận, ta được kết quả như sau:

    Xuất hiện bản ghi có ngày bắt đầu như ta  vừa nhập phía trên
    Xuất hiện bản ghi có ngày bắt đầu như ta vừa nhập phía trên

    Kết quả truy vấn đưa ra chi tiết của dự án bắt đầu vào 2/12/2016.

    Bạn có thể đi đến View Design và chạy lại truy vấn với ngày bắt đầu khác.

    Nhập ngày 22 tháng 1 năm 2017 (định dạng m/d/y)
    Nhập ngày 22 tháng 1 năm 2017 (định dạng m/d/y)

    Kết quả truy vấn trả về là chi tiết dự án khác với ngày bắt đầu như hình trên. Lặp lại với những ngày bạn cần.

    Tìm dự án diễn ra trong một khoảng thời gian xác định

    Với các truy vấn thông thường, ta sẽ tra cứu dự án được đặt trong khoảng thời gian nhất định bằng cách sử dụng tiêu chí kiểm soát "Between x and y" và thay thế x với y bằng các thời điểm cụ thể tương ứng. Tuy vậy, với truy vấn tham số, bạn có thể thay thế x và y bằng các cụm từ sẽ xuất hiện trong thông báo yêu cầu nhập từ khóa.

    Lúc này Criteria của cột NgayBatdau sẽ có dạng như sau:

    Between [Nhập ngày bắt đầu dự án đầu tiên:] And [Nhập ngày bắt đầu dự án cuối cùng:]
    Hai cụm từ sẽ xuất hiện trong thông báo khi chạy truy vấn
    Hai cụm từ sẽ xuất hiện trong thông báo khi chạy truy vấn

    Khi đó nếu bạn khởi chạy truy vấn thì cả 2 thông báo gợi ý trên sẽ lần lượt xuất hiện và yêu cầu bạn nhập vào thời điểm bạn muốn.

    Nhập thời điểm vào cả 2 thông báo lần lượt xuất hiện
    Nhập thời điểm vào cả 2 thông báo lần lượt xuất hiện

    Click OK để xác nhận, ta được kết quả như sau:

    Xuất hiện các dự án nằm trong khoảng thời gian trên
    Xuất hiện các dự án nằm trong khoảng thời gian trên

    Mẹo khi tạo lập các câu truy vấn tham số

    Lý tưởng nhất, câu hỏi gợi ý trong thông báo khi chạy truy vấn cần phải làm rõ từ khóa tìm kiếm thuộc loại dữ liệu gì, theo định dạng nào thì phù hợp. Chẳng hạn, để chắc chắn rằng người dùng điền đúng từ khóa theo định dạng giống với cơ sở dữ liệu gốc, ta có thể điền vào trường TimeBatdau trong mục Criteria như sau: [Ngày bắt đầu dự án (mm/dd/yyyy):] để làm rõ hơn keyword cần điền

    Bài trước: Truy vấn Hành động (Action Query) trong Access 2016

    Bài tiếp: Tiêu chí thay thế (Alternate Criteria) trong Access 2016


    ==***==

    Khoá học Quản trị Chiến lược Dành cho Lãnh đạo Doanh nghiệp

    Nhấn vào đây để bắt đầu khóa học

    ==***==
    Nơi hội tụ Tinh Hoa Tri Thức - Khơi nguồn Sáng tạo
    Để tham gia khóa học công nghệ truy cập link: http://thuvien.hocviendaotao.com
    Mọi hỗ trợ về công nghệ email: dinhanhtuan68@gmail.com
    --- 

    Khóa học Hacker và Marketing từ A-Z trên ZALO!

    Khóa học Hacker và Marketing từ A-Z trên Facebook!

    Khóa đào tạo Power BI phân tích báo cáo để bán hàng thành công

    Bảo mật và tấn công Website - Hacker mũ trắng
    Hacker mũ trắng
    KHÓA HỌC LẬP TRÌNH PYTHON TỪ CƠ BẢN ĐẾN CHUYÊN NGHIỆP

    Khóa học Lập trình Visual Foxpro 9 - Dành cho nhà quản lý và kế toán

    Khóa học hướng dẫn về Moodle chuyên nghiệp và hay
    Xây dựng hệ thống đào tạo trực tuyến chuyên nghiệp tốt nhất hiện nay.



    Khóa học AutoIt dành cho dân IT và Marketing chuyên nghiệp

    Khoá học Word từ cơ bản tới nâng cao, học nhanh, hiểu sâu


    Khóa học hướng dẫn sử dụng Powerpoint từ đơn giản đến phức tạp HIỆU QUẢ
    Khóa học Thiết kế, quản lý dữ liệu dự án chuyên nghiệp cho doanh nghiệp bằng Bizagi
    Khoa hoc hay
    Khóa học Phân tích dữ liệu sử dụng Power Query trong Excel

    Khóa học Lập trình WEB bằng PHP từ cơ bản đến nâng cao

    Khóa học Phân tích dữ liệu sử dụng TableAU - Chìa khóa thành công!
    Nhấn vào đây để bắt đầu khóa học


    Khóa học Phân tích dữ liệu sử dụng SPSS - Chìa khóa thành công!


    Khóa học "Thiết kế bài giảng điện tử", Video, hoạt hình 
    kiếm tiền Youtube bằng phần mềm Camtasia Studio
    Khóa học HƯỚNG DẪN THIẾT KẾ VIDEO CLIP CHO DÂN MARKETING CHUYÊN NGHIỆP
    Xây dựng website​​​​
    HƯỚNG DẪN THIẾT KẾ QUẢNG CÁO VÀ ĐỒ HỌA CHUYÊN NGHIỆP VỚI CANVA
    Hãy tham gia khóa học để trở thành người chuyên nghiệp. Tuyệt HAY!😲👍
    Khoa hoc hay
    MICROSOFT ACCESS



    GOOGLE SPREADSHEETS phê không tưởng
    Khoa hoc hay
    Khóa hoc lập trình bằng Python tại đây

    Hãy tham gia khóa học để biết mọi thứ

    Để tham gia tất cả các bài học, Bạn nhấn vào đây 

    Khóa học lập trình cho bé MSWLogo
    Nhấn vào đây để bắt đầu học
    Nhấn vào đây để bắt đầu học


    Khóa học Ba, Mẹ và Bé - Cùng bé lập trình  TUYỆT VỜI

    Khoa hoc hay

    Khóa học sử dụng Adobe Presenter-Tạo bài giảng điện tử
    Khoa hoc hay
    Design Website

    Để thành thạo Wordpress bạn hãy tham gia khóa học 
    Khóa học sử dụng Edmodo để dạy và học hiện đại để thành công
    ==***==
    Bảo hiểm nhân thọ - Bảo vệ người trụ cột
    Cập nhật công nghệ từ Youtube tại link: congnghe.hocviendaotao.com
    Tham gia nhóm Facebook
    Để tham gia khóa học công nghệ truy cập link: http://thuvien.hocviendaotao.com
    Mọi hỗ trợ về công nghệ email: dinhanhtuan68@gmail.com

    About Học viện đào tạo trực tuyến

    Xinh chào bạn. Tôi là Đinh Anh Tuấn - Thạc sĩ CNTT. Email: dinhanhtuan68@gmail.com .
    - Nhận đào tạo trực tuyến lập trình dành cho nhà quản lý, kế toán bằng Foxpro, Access 2010, Excel, Macro Excel, Macro Word, chứng chỉ MOS cao cấp, IC3, tiếng anh, phần mềm, phần cứng .
    - Nhận thiết kế phần mềm quản lý, Web, Web ứng dụng, quản lý, bán hàng,... Nhận Thiết kế bài giảng điện tử, số hóa tài liệu...
    HỌC VIỆN ĐÀO TẠO TRỰC TUYẾN:TẬN TÂM-CHẤT LƯỢNG.
    «
    Next
    Bài đăng Mới hơn
    »
    Previous
    Bài đăng Cũ hơn